Abstract

A bumper arrangement for motor vehicles consists of a deformation-resistant support, which extends transversely with respect to the longitudinal direction of the vehicle and is supported with respect to the vehicle. A covering covers the support and has an edge portion with a deformation-resistant strip which is fastened at an adjacent body portion of the motor vehicle. The covering can be adjusted with respect to the adjacent body portion to be flush with the shell of the body portion by locally arranged clamping elements braced against a recess-shaped area of the body. The clamping elements are prepositioned and held at the body by screwable fastening members which interact with spreading members and which are operated from an interior space of the vehicle.

What is claimed is: 
     
       1. A bumper arrangement for motor vehicles having an adjustable covering; a deformation-resistant support which extends transversely with respect to the longitudinal direction of the vehicle and is supported with respect to the vehicle;   a covering means which covers the deformation-resistant support;   an edge portion of the covering means being provided with a deformation-resistant strip which is fastened at an adjacent body portion of the motor vehicle;   the improvement comprising: that the edge portion of the covering means is braced against a recess-shaped area of the adjacent body portion by locally arranged clamping element means;   the clamping element means being prepositioned at the adjacent body and held in position by operatable screwable fastening elements; and   the fastening elements interacting with spreading element means, operated from an interior space of the vehicle, to cause the spreading element means to apply a force to the clamping element means to cause the clamping element means to brace the edge portion of the covering means against the recessed-shaped area of the adjacent body portion.   
     
     
       2. A bumper arrangement according to claim 1, wherein the recess-shaped area for the fastening of the edge portion of the covering means comprises an approximately horizontally extending wall portion, an approximately vertically aligned wall portion, and a connecting, diagonally extending corner area. 
     
     
       3. A bumper arrangement according to claim 1, wherein the clamping element means is angularly shaped and has two differently aligned contact surfaces and a supporting surface, and wherein the edge portion of the covering means is braced between the supporting surface and a horizontal wall portion of the body portion. 
     
     
       4. A bumper arrangement according to claim 2, wherein the clamping element means is angularly shaped and has two differently aligned contact surfaces and a supporting surface, and wherein the edge portion of the covering means is braced between the supporting surface and the horizontal wall portion. 
     
     
       5. A bumper arrangement according to claim 3, wherein the supporting surface is provided with a groove-shaped profiling at a side facing the deformation-resistant strip. 
     
     
       6. A bumper arrangement according to claim 4, wherein the support surface is provided with a groove-shaped profiling at a side facing the deformation-resistant strip. 
     
     
       7. A bumper arrangement according to claim 3, wherein the contact surfaces and the supporting surface are provided as self-supporting arms of the clamping element means. 
     
     
       8. A bumper arrangement according to claim 4, wherein the contact surfaces and the supporting surface are provided as self-supporting arms of the clamping element means. 
     
     
       9. A bumper arrangement according to claim 1, wherein the clamping element means is formed by an extruded profile. 
     
     
       10. A bumper arrangement according to claim 7, wherein the arm of the clamping element means forming the supporting surface can be moved upward against the edge portion of the covering means by the spreading element means that interacts with the fastening element. 
     
     
       11. A bumper arrangement according to claim 8, wherein the arm of the clamping element means forming the supporting surface can be moved upward against the edge portion of the covering means by the spreading element means that interacts with the fastening element. 
     
     
       12. A bumper arrangement according to claim 3, wherein a protuberant positioning pin is arranged on one of the two contact surfaces of the clamping element means, and wherein the positioning pin is guided through an opening of the vertical wall portion. 
     
     
       13. A bumper arrangement according to claim 10, wherein the spreading element means is wedge-shaped and is inserted into a recess of the clamping element means. 
     
     
       14. A bumper arrangement according to claim 11, wherein the spreading element means is wedge-shaped and is inserted into a recess of the clamping element means. 
     
     
       15. A bumper arrangement according to claim 13, wherein the spreading element means can be inserted into the recess from the side and is secured against falling-out in the direction of the fastening element. 
     
     
       16. A bumper arrangement according to claim 13, wherein the spreading element means faces the recess at two sides, each of which has a groove-shaped molded-out piece which engage in trough-shaped groves of the recess. 
     
     
       17. A bumper arrangement according to claim 14, wherein the spreading element means faces the recess at two sides, each of which has a groove-shaped molded-out piece which engage in trough-shaped groves of the recess. 
     
     
       18. A bumper arrangement according to claim 13, wherein a stop is provided in the recess to limit the movement of a contact surface of the clamping element means upward against the edge portion. 
     
     
       19. A bumper arrangement according to claim 3, wherein one of the contact surfaces of the clamping element means is provided with a predetermined bending point which is defined by a recess and an opposite transverse groove. 
     
     
       20. A bumper arrangement according to claim 11, wherein a head of the fastening element is accommodated in the spreading element means and is secured with respect to torsion, and wherein a free end of the fastening element extends through the diagonally extending corner area of the recess-shaped area into the interior of the vehicle; and wherein a nut is placed onto the free end of the fastening element for bracing of clamping element means.
